[0005] The purpose of the present invention is to provide a method and system for person detection, body part location, age estimation and gender identification in network pictures, including: 1. training face classifiers on face samples; 2. training pedestrians on pedestrian samples Classifier; 3. Train AAM model data on face samples; 4. Train age and gender recognition classifiers on face samples of different genders and ages; 5. Load their respective classifiers to realize person detection in network pictures , body part positioning, age estimation and gender identification; the specific steps are as follows:

[0006] 1. Face classifier training process

[0007] Collect face positive and negative samples, do histogram equalization and normalize to 24×24 size;

[0008] Extract Haar-Like features from face samples;

[0009] Pass the face features into Adaboost training to get a face classifier;

[0010] 2. Pedestrian classifier training process

Abstract

The invention provides a method and system for figure detection, body part positioning, age estimation and gender identification in a picture of a network. The method includes the steps that by means of a face detection technique based on Haar-Like characteristics and Adaboost trainings and a pedestrian detection technique based on HOG characteristics and SVM trainings, a face area and an overall body area are primarily detected, and then a further fusion is carried out so that a face can correspond to a body if the body exists; active appearance models (AAM) are used in the face part so as to position the positions of the five sense organs of the face, and the position of the upper half body, the position of the lower half body, the positions of the left hand and the right hand, and the position of feet are confirmed on a body part according to a human body geometric model; eventually, identification of gender and age is carried out on the face part according to GIST characteristics and an SVM. Therefore, whether a figure exists in the picture of the network and various biological characteristics of the figure can be obtained through calculation.

technical field [0001] The invention relates to a method and system for person detection, body part positioning, age estimation and gender recognition in network pictures, which belongs to the field of image recognition, and specifically performs face detection and upright body detection in static pictures, and then Position the hair, eyes, nose, cheeks, and mouth on the face, and estimate the age and gender of the face; position the upper body, lower body, feet, and left and right hands on the body. Background technique [0002] The pictures on the Internet are mainly people. Whether it is a news picture or a product picture, most of the pictures are related to people, that is to say, there are people in most of the pictures. Faces or pedestrians can be detected by face detection technology and pedestrian detection technology, but there is no more research on the fine positioning of each part.
